Der "standard broadcast kanal" benutzt als encryption key AQ==, also einen einzelnen null-byte. Unter welchem Namen du den eingespeichert hast ist egal.

Dieser Kanal wird auch fleißig benutzt zurzeit. :) Einen extra Fusion Kanal einzurichten würde nur zu fragmentierung der community führen.

Das preset das alle benutzen ist "long range - fast" übrigens.

(Disclaimer: I just freshly learned about Meshtastic this year and only used it for the first time. Also, I am not knowledgeable in radio communications tech.)

Speaking of my personal experience this year, just using 2x RAK Meshtastic Starter Kit with the PCB antenna and a 3d-printed case, Meshtastic worked really well for my friend and me. It seems we were able to reach each other reliably via Meshtastic chat messages during the whole festival, thus being able to meet at several occasions. Most messages were shown as confirmed after 1 or 2 seconds in the Meshtastic app.

Our devices had no display, so we were using the app for everything. We had problems with location sharing in the iOS app though. As a result, we were not really using the location feature.

I had a wow moment inside Datscha. My smartphone would not show any cellular reception, but Meshtastic messages somehow still made their way out successfully.

Also, with reporting from people who had internet access during some stormy periods, the default LongFast channel quickly became known as The Weather Channel. Loved it ;)

Some general conclusions from this year's usage: According to the speaker of the comms talk, up to 200 nodes were active at the festival (my devices only saw 80 though). Talking to some people after the talk, I learned that we saw quite a high level of channel airtime utilization – up to 50%. If I understood correctly, this could mean that the network will not scale much more than double the amount of users / traffic. So we might reach some limits if there are more users next time.
